Parallel Learning Structure
An alternative and supportive framework within organizations aimed at fostering innovation and knowledge sharing outside the constraints of the formal organizational chart.
Social Structure
The organized pattern of social relationships and social institutions that together compose society.
Appreciative Inquiry
An approach focused on exploring and amplifying strengths, successes, and positive potential in an organization or group.
Action Research
A reflective process of progressive problem-solving led by individuals working with others in teams or as part of a "community of practice" to improve the way they address issues and solve problems.
